One of the primary benefits of DNA testing while in the womb is the early detection of genetic disorders By analyzing the baby’s DNA through a simple blood test or amniocentesis procedure, doctors can identify genetic abnormalities such as Down syndrome, cystic fibrosis, and spinal muscular atrophy This early detection allows parents to prepare for any potential health concerns their child may face and seek appropriate medical care and support.

In addition to detecting genetic disorders, DNA testing while in the womb can also provide valuable information about the baby’s paternity In cases where there may be uncertainty about the identity of the father, a prenatal DNA test can confirm paternity with a high level of accuracy This can help to establish legal rights and responsibilities, as well as provide peace of mind for all parties involved.

Despite the many advantages of DNA testing while in the womb, it is important to consider the ethical implications of this procedure Some argue that prenatal DNA testing raises concerns about genetic discrimination and the potential for parents to make decisions based on the baby’s genetic profile It is crucial that parents approach DNA testing while in the womb with careful consideration and consult with a genetic counselor to fully understand the implications of the results.
